On Wed, Jun 20, 2012 at 01:00:01PM -0700, Junio C Hamano wrote:

> Jeff King <peff@xxxxxxxx> writes:
> 
> > This was mostly sorted already, but put things like
> > "cache-tree.h" after "cache.h", even though "-" comes before
> > "." (at least in the C locale). This will make it easier to
> > keep the list sorted later by piping it through "sort".
> 
> I agree this would make it easier to blindly run "sort", but I think
> the result hurts scannability.  Is it a good change?

I don't personally see a difference, but if you do, I don't care that
much about this patch. The main motive was that the next patch involved
adding 10 new entries, and I didn't want to have to insert them
manually into the correct sorting spots.
